Being in Martial Arts for over 30 years I highly recommend Bujinkan Hawaii Dojo!

Are you looking for traditional up-to-date, & current training in traditional Japanese Martial Arts?

In Bujinkan Hawaii Dojo they study and teach nine combat martial arts lineages known as ryūha (6 traditional Japanese Jujutsu Schools and 3 Ninpo- Ninjitsu Schools). Students work with all forms of unarmed combat and weapons as part of the curriculum. Strictly defined, Ninpo Budo Taijutsu consists of combat arts (Budo) though, those arts that have a spiritual component, and which go beyond combat effectiveness and serve the purpose of continual refinement for personal improvement and introspection as a warrior.

Are you looking for spiritual and physical development as well as mental training for learning survival and fighting strategy?

This is what they do and teach!... with integrity and respect while safety and care of students is always taken very seriously during each training.

Bujinkan Hawaii Dojo is not a big commercialized Dojo but rather a traditional Ryuha style dojo. The Bujinkan Hawaii Dojo Instructors do teach in the same manner as Soke and Japanese Shihans Master-teachers from Japan.

I was first introduced to Bujinkan through Shihan Prather of the Yamaneko Dojol. He informed me that for quality training on Oahu I should find Shihan Frasier, he was "the real deal." I did just that in early 2012. Classes are small and regulated, anyone with a criminal background cannot train as per Bujinkan regulation and there is an interview process. Immediately, I found the training and the instructors to be both realistic and effective, in addition there was no attitude of superiority or dissension between students. Attitudes are left off the mat. The training sessions are hard and somewhat freeform, instructors will begin with a kata and allow it to develop on its own as the class progresses, so you never know where the class will end up. There are strikes and takedowns involved, as well as the use of weapons, but the entire class is watched over and the students carefully mentored by the senior instructors. I have yet to see anyone seriously injured during class as a result of practicing the techniques. Based on the real world applicability of the movements and the quality of the instructors, I would recommend this dojo to anyone looking to train in Japanese self defense and/or close-quarter combat.
